This is what neglect does to a hotel. My family started staying here when I was a teenager back in the 70's and we always liked it but as time went by it really became run down. It's too bad because in general Hilton's are rather decent. (although this particular one was privately owned by Merv Griffin) I remember the penthouse restaurant in the pre Stardust days when it was L'Escoffier and it was as fabulous as a restaurant could be. In fact many people claim Merv bought the hotel just so he could always have his favorite table there. The current Stardust is not noteworthy. You get the feeling that this was a wonderful place in days gone by but it has fallen into ruin. The hotel has a shabby sense about it. Again, it's ashame because it was such a glorious place & in a primo location. If you are in Beverly Hills go to any number of other very fine, elegant hotels. This one will be a let down.

This landmark palace hosts one of the industry's most important award shows.. In Short
After a complete facelift to the lobby, landscaping and rooms in 1999, the property, like many of her guests, now looks a lot younger than her 40-plus years. One can recapture the old-school elegance of Beverly Hills while staying here, from the live poolside music on summer weekends to the excitement surrounding the Golden Globes, which is held in the ballroom every January. The large guest rooms are quite lovely, and most offer terraces and city views.
